What are the highest and lowest points in Kansas?

The highest point in Kansas is Mount Sunflower, with an elevation of 4,039 feet (1,231 meters) above sea level. The lowest point in Kansas is the Verdigris River, which flows along the southeastern border of the state and has an elevation of 679 feet (207 meters) above sea level.

What is the highest temperature recorded in kansas and when did it occur?

The highest temperature recorded in Kansas is 121 degrees Fahrenheit recorded on July 24, 1936 at Alton, Kansas.
